Western Balkan countries are at various stages of their path towards future European Union membership. Formal accession procedures aside, in this paper we take a brief look at the economic convergence between them and the EU. We use several indicators to assess and compare the degree of real convergence of each country to the union, focusing on the level of GDP per capita and the production structures at the sector level. The results reveal a moderate convergence process, with some specifics by country, that paints a cautiously optimistic outlook regarding their future in the EU.
